     * A token used for optimistic locking. WAF returns a token to your get and list requests,
     * to mark the state of the entity at the time of the request. To make changes to the entity associated with the
     * token, you provide the token to operations like update and delete. WAF uses the token
     * to ensure that no changes have been made to the entity since you last retrieved it. If a change has been made,
     * the update fails with a WAFOptimisticLockException. If this happens, perform another
     * get, and use the new token returned by that operation.
